James L. Adams

James L. Adams chairs the Values, Technology, Science and Society Department at Stanford University. Trained as an engineer at CalTech, he also studied at the UCLA art school and worked on spacecraft at the Jet Propulsion Laboratory.

Adams is a popular teacher at Stanford and lectures and consults in the field of creativity around the word.
